Mechanism of Cysteine Desulfurase Slr0387 from Synechocystis sp. PCC 6803: Kinetic Analysis of Cleavage of the Persulfide Intermediate by Chemical Reductants
Cysteine desulfurases (CDs) are pyridoxal-5‘-phosphate (PLP)-dependent enzymes that cleave sulfur from cysteine via an enzyme cysteinyl persulfide intermediate. In vitro studies of these enzymes have generally employed dithiothreitol as a cosubstrate to reductively cleave the persulfide intermediate...
